A Closer Look at the Snorkeling Cozumel Reefs Tour

This trip is designed as a full-day adventure, starting early to make the most of your time exploring Cozumel’s underwater marvels. The logistics are straightforward: you get hotel pick-up in Cancun or the Riviera Maya around 6:20 A.M., followed by transportation to Playa del Carmen’s ferry terminal. From there, you’ll catch an 8:00 A.M. ferry to Cozumel, arriving ready for a day of underwater discovery.
Once in Cozumel, your guide Manuel will meet the group and take everyone directly to the boat. The boat itself is described as fully equipped, ensuring comfort and safety while you’re out on the water. It’s worth noting the tour caters to both snorkelers and certified divers—so whether you prefer to stay on the surface or explore below, everyone gets their moment to enjoy.

Included amenities and logistics
The fact that snorkeling gear is included is a big plus, especially for travelers who don’t want to pack extra equipment or worry about rentals. Water and soft drinks are provided throughout, keeping you hydrated during the warm day.
Between snorkeling sessions, the crew serves a delicious lunch—a welcome break that lets you rest and refuel. The tour wraps up around 3:00 P.M., after which you’ll head back to the ferry terminal, purchase your return tickets, and get transported back to your hotel in Cancun or the Riviera Maya.

FAQ

Is transportation included in the tour?
Yes, the tour includes hotel pickup in Cancun or Riviera Maya and transportation to the ferry terminal, as well as the return transfer from Playa del Carmen back to Cancun.
What is the duration of the tour?
The total experience lasts about 6 hours, starting early in the morning and ending around 3:00 P.M., including travel time and activities.
Are snorkeling gear provided?
Yes, all snorkeling gear is included, so you don’t need to bring your own.
Can beginners join this tour?
Absolutely. The tour is suitable for snorkelers of all levels, and guides are experienced in assisting those new to snorkeling.
What should I bring?
While gear is provided, you might want to bring sunscreen, a towel, a hat, and possibly a waterproof camera to capture the underwater beauty.
Is lunch included?
Yes, a delicious lunch and drinks are served on board between the snorkeling sessions.
What about cancellation?
You can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, providing flexibility if your plans change.
